Gameplay Programmer
About the Company
WarnerMedia is a leading media and entertainment company that creates and distributes premium and popular content from a diverse array of talented storytellers and journalists to global audiences through its consumer brands including: HBO, HBO Max, Warner Bros., TNT, TBS, truTV, CNN, DC Entertainment, New Line, Cartoon Network, Adult Swim, Turner Classic Movies and others.
About WB Games Montréal
WB Games Montréal is a division of Warner Bros Interactive Entertainment (WBIE). Founded in 2010, we are 300+ creative team members strong who join forces every day to create unforgettable AAA experiences across all platforms.
The Production Team at WB Games Montreal is proud to offer permanent flexibility to its employees. Remote working is allowed, even when our offices will reopen. This policy applies to anyone with legal permission to work in Canada and located in Canada only.
Job Description
WB Games Montreal, a division of Warner Bros. Interactive Entertainment (WBIE), seeks a Gameplay Programmer to work closely with designers and the Gameplay Lead to design, explore, and implement various gameplay systems.
Job Responsibilities
-
Work closely with designers, artists, and other engineers to create a great player experience.
-
Collaborate with members of the team to build sustainable, performant and maintainable technologies and code.
-
Play an active role in supporting the game, addressing both low level and high-level issues.
Job Qualifications
Experience
-
4+ years of experience in game development.
-
Fluent in C++.
-
Strong mathematics skills (linear algebra and trigonometry).
-
Experience in the design and implementation of 3Cs (Camera, Character, Control) and gameplay support systems.
-
Experience with multi-threaded programming paradigms.
-
Experience with Unreal Engine and Multiplayer architecture is a plus.
Education
- Bachelor’s degree in computer science or a relevant discipline is preferred.
Knowledge/Skills
- Ability to communicate with designers.
